23 Nov 2022S1:E4 – Freya Betts: Lessons learned from living off grid and going back to basics to create authentic art00:48:03

In this episode, PosterSpy founder and host Jack Woodhams chats with illustrator Freya Betts. Freya has produced illustrations for Disney, Marvel, Netflix and Royal Mail.

Her work has been printed far and wide; notable projects include an exclusive t-shirt range in H&M as well as wall murals across London, New York, and San Fransisco for Uber.

21 Dec 2022S1:E6 – Nuno Sarnadas: Photo composite tips & tricks, the benefits of social media & why AI is a danger00:54:40

Welcome to Episode 6 of the PosterSpy podcast- I’m Jack Woodhams founder of the website and your host.

This episode's guest is designer and illustrator Nuno Sarnadas, Nuno is currently a full time designer and between making official posters for short films and features he also makes a lot of his own fan posters. Which collectively have been viewed over 400,000 times on the PosterSpy website.

In this episode we discus how competitive the poster scene can be, why the use of social media has benefited Nuno’s career and why Ai is becoming a big problem in the creative industry.

25 Apr 2024S2:E5 – Doaly: What it takes to go freelance, the importance of pacing yourself and how I find new clients01:13:17

Welcome to The PosterSpy Podcast, I’m Jack Woodhams founder of the PosterSpy and your host.

Today I’m chatting with Doaly, a UK based artist and good friend of mine who has been creating alternative movie posters, comic covers and more for the best part of a decade.

His work quickly gained notoriety after releasing several art prints with Bottleneck Gallery which later secured him work with clients such as Marvel, Lucasfilm, Disney and others.

We chat about how his work developed, how he first entered the scene, where he sees his work going in the future and much more.

09 Nov 2022S1:E3 – Matt Ferguson: The importance of collaborating, accepting criticism and why focusing on your own journey is key00:49:22

In this episode, PosterSpy founder and host Jack Woodhams chats with illustrator and co-founder of vice press Matt Ferguson - Matt’s probably best known for his Marvel artwork which he produces in partnership with Disney.

Alongside that, Matt has created official posters for a number of huge franchises, including Star Wars, Stranger Things, The Lord of the Rings, Blade Runner, Indiana Jones and many more.

26 Oct 2022S1:E2 – James Henshaw: Setting up Vice Press, quitting a bank job and what I look for when hiring artists00:51:43

In this episode PosterSpy founder and host Jack Woodhams chats to James Henshaw, who co-founded Vice Press along with illustrator Matt Ferguson in 2015.

This is a hugely insightful episode that covers many aspects of how James and Matt run the gallery and what they look for when working with artists.

About Vice Press: Based in Sheffield, U.K and founded in 2015 by James Henshaw and artist Matt Ferguson, Vice Press are dedicated to producing new and unique, limited edition and officially licensed art prints, movie posters, clothing, pin badges and collectibles from cult titles, modern classics and new releases in film, T.V, comics and games.

We work with like minded artists, printers and manufacturers from across the world to create original and distinctive, premium hand crafted designs for fans like us to collect & display in their home.

25 Jan 2023S1:E7 – Nada Maktari: The importance of critique, openness and how being selective helps my growth00:55:32

This episode's guest is designer and illustrator Nada Maktari. Nada’s work has attracted a lot of attention over the past year, particularly due to her style that appears to merge her two passions of architecture and illustration.

In 2022 she released an officially licensed 'Dune' screen print with Bottleneck Gallery as well as a fine-Art print with Moor-Art Gallery.

In this podcast we discuss her design background, what inspires her art, her plans for 2023 and much more.

25 Oct 2023S2:E3 – Hannah Gillingham: Finding an agent and how to improve the visibility of your work to get new clients00:48:21

In this episode, I’m joined by guest Hannah Gillingham, a UK-based illustrator who recently signed to renowned agency Jelly, which later led to her work being on display in Times Square which is a massive achievement. Her work is known for its painterly and figurative style.

Recently, she has created artwork for a wide range of clients including Disney, Lucasfilm, Spotify, Adult Swim, RSPB, Moor-Art Gallery & more. And in during our chat we discuss her inspirations, approach to art, what challenges she faces as an illustrator and much more.
